Invited is a premier leader in the hospitality and service industry, dedicated to creating exceptional experiences for its members and guests. Since its founding in 1957, Invited has grown to become the largest owner and operator of private clubs across the United States, boasting a network of over 130 country clubs, city clubs, and athletic clubs. With a workforce exceeding 17,000 employees, Invited places a strong emphasis on building meaningful relationships and enhancing the lives of all who are part of its community. Job Requirements
- Must be able to stand walk and perform physical activities for extended periods
- Ability to work in varying temperatures and environments with potential exposure to dust fumes or gases
- Capable of climbing ladders squatting kneeling reaching grasping twisting bending and folding unfolding as required
- Able to lift carry push and pull up to 100 lbs occasionally
- Effective communication skills including talking and hearing with sufficient visual acuity
Job Qualifications
- High school diploma or equivalent
- Previous experience in food and beverage service
- Current Food Handler and Alcohol Server Certifications as required by state and city regulations
- Completion of Invited’s F&B Service Training program
- Excellent communication skills with the ability to speak clearly and effectively
- Ability to follow instructions and communicate well with team members
Job Duties
- Maintain high standards of service following the Invited F&B service training program
- Provide food and beverage service to members and guests executing orders in a timely manner
- Ensure a complete knowledge of the à la carte menu including daily features and specials
- Greet members by name and provide a warm welcome making them feel at home
- Assist fellow employees and ensure a seamless member and guest experience through teamwork and attention to detail
- Handle member and guest complaints with service recovery techniques ensuring any issues are resolved promptly
- Complete daily assignments and side work ensuring work areas are organized clean and well-stocked
